When Newport County goalkeeper Tom King took a goal kick in a League Two game at Cheltenham Town on Tuesday, little did he know he would be writing his name into the Guinness World Records book for the longest goal ever scored.

Tanguy Ndombele’s Breath-Taking Stunner Helps Tottenham Win At Sheffield United

Tottenham Hotspur's record signing Tanguy Ndombele conjured a moment of magic to seal his side's 3-1 victory at the Premier League's bottom club Sheffield United on Sunday.

Spurs had just seen the commanding lead given to them by Serge Aurier and Harry Kane halved by David McGoldrick's header on the hour when Ndombele struck with an audacious flicked lob.

Napoli Scores The Best Goal Of The Weekend, Courtesy Of Lorenzo Insigne And Chucky Lozano

Lorenzo Insigne scored twice and produced a dazzling assist as Napoli stormed into third place in Serie A with a crushing 6-0 victory over Fiorentina on Sunday.

Striker Andrea Petagna teed up Insigne to fire home after just five minutes, and Petagna was again the provider when he teed up Diego Demme for the second.

Insigne produced a moment of magic on the 38th minute, winning the ball inside his own half and embarking on a winding dribble past several opposition defenders, before playing an inch-perfect pass behind the defense for Hirving Lozano to tap in.

FA Cup: Crawley Town Stuns Leeds United; Chelsea And Manchester City Ease Through

Premier League Leeds United suffered the biggest upset of the FA Cup Third Round when they fell to a 3-0 defeat by fourth-tier Crawley Town on Sunday as Manchester City and Chelsea eased through.

A brilliant solo strike from Nick Tsaroulla in the 50th minute put League Two Crawley in front after a first half in which Leeds had caused them few problems.

AS Roma And Inter Milan Exchange Haymakers In Serie A Barn Burner

Gianluca Mancini's late goal earned AS Roma a 2-2 draw at home to Inter Milan on Sunday which left the visitors three points behind leaders AC Milan in the Serie A title race.

Lorenzo Pellegrini’s deflected shot put the hosts in front at halftime, but Inter mustered a spirited response and Milan Škriniar headed in a deserved equalizer after the break. Achraf Hakimi put Inter ahead by curling an outstanding shot in off the bar, but Mancini's glancing header leveled the scores with four minutes remaining to clinch a sixth consecutive league draw between the two teams.
